WEST SILOAM SPRINGS – Doug Stone, known for telling tales of heartbreak and triumph, will take the stage at Seven Bar inside Cherokee Casino & Hotel West Siloam Springs on Thursday, Aug. 22, at 8 p.m.
The show is free to the public, ages 21 and over.
With hits like “Jukebox and Country Songs” and “Too Busy to Love,” Stone dominated the country music world throughout the 1990s. Despite health challenges, including quadruple bypass surgery, Stone’s determination never wavered. His tenacity didn’t stop with music, as he also branched out into acting, appearing in films like “Gordy” and “God of Storms.”
Stone’s talent and tenacity culminated in an association with Epic Records in his 30s, where he released his self-titled debut album in 1990. His debut album skyrocketed with chart-topping singles like “I’d Be Better Off (In a Pine Box)” and “In a Different Light,” garnering critical acclaim and a Grammy nomination. Subsequent albums like “From the Heart” and “More Love” earned him multiple platinum and gold certifications, solidifying his status as a country music icon.
